Vertical oscillation of a mass on spring: equilibrium is displaced downward by d = mg/k. If mass is pulled extra distance x₀ and released, amplitude of oscillation is:
- Ad + x₀
- Bx₀Correct
- Cd
- Dx₀ − d
Correct answer
x₀
Explanation
In vertical spring-mass: the equilibrium position is the new origin. Additional displacement from new equilibrium = x₀. Amplitude of oscillation about new equilibrium = x₀.
